The City of Kissimmee is now accepting requests for the “Santa Calling Program,” an annual tradition taking place on Wednesday, December 2, from 5:30 p.m. to 8:00 p.m.

Parents interested in having Santa Claus call their children may send the following information via e-mail to santa@kissimmee.org:

  • Child’s name and pronunciation
  • Age (10 years old or younger)
  • English or Spanish speaker
  • Gender
  • Phone number
  • A list of what they want from Santa Claus
  • Names and ages of the siblings
  • School/ Grade/ teacher
  • Pet type and their names
  • Parents, what would you like your child to improve on something positive?
  • Do you have an Elf on the Shelf? Is it a girl or a boy? Name?
  • First-time call or returning callBest time to call between 5:30 p.m. and 8:00 p.m. on Wednesday, December 2?

“Santa Calling” is a phone calling service and not a gift-giving service. The deadline to receive requests will be on Wednesday, November 25, at 5:00 p.m. Please remember the time and day selected as Santa will be calling many children, and Santa will only call each child once.
